Job Description Summary
The position is responsible for achieving SFE monthly target for the assigned territory customers or therapeutic area by promoting effectively the different ethical products to healthcare professionals through the execution of approved marketing strategies and programs. The position is also expected to collaborate with colleagues use expertise and strong professional relationships to enable the right patient to get the right solution at the right time.Job Description
Major accountabilities:
Achievement of Market Share Target
Demonstrate improvement on brand metrics through Brand awareness/ recall message retention prescription intent and trial rate.
Ensure positive customer experience in reference to Net Promoter score Overall HCP satisfaction rating and HCP Retention rate
Attain market share objective
Achieve monthly sales targets
Meet other set key performance indicators (KPIs)

Minimum Requirements:
Education
4-year course preferably business and allied medical sciences from a reputable institution.
Work Experience:
Established Network to target Customer Group desirable.
At least 1 2 years of strong track record as a Specialist Representative or solid exposure in pharmaceutical selling i.e. brand selling and developing brand advocates
Digital / engagement track record preferable
Digital savvy
Mastery on product knowledge clinical studies and updates on the assigned therapy area
Expert on patient-centric selling using omnichannel engagement tools and framework
